## Step 7: Migrate the thumbnail generation queue to Pellinor v3

Before merging, verify that the worker pool for the Snapgrove thumbnail queue has been repointed from the legacy `thumbs-v2` exchange to the new Pellinor v3 topic. Reviewers should confirm that retry semantics are preserved: the v3 queue uses exponential backoff with a dead-letter route, whereas v2 silently dropped failures after three attempts. For reference during review, the complete post-migration queue configuration is shown below.

deployment values, yadug-bawif:
[framir]
team = pelox
access_code = ac_a38ab2
owner = tamion.julael
host = framir.tolvaqlabs.test
port = 11211
peer = tammir.zemvargrid.local
salt = 2215ef03
pin = 1541

## Runbook: Gridsmith crossword generator

If puzzle generation stalls, check the wordlist index first — rebuilds after dictionary updates take ~4 min. Do not restart the solver mid-grid; partial grids corrupt the daily queue. Drain the queue, restart, then regenerate from seed. Confirm output against the acceptance grid before release. The current release corresponds to the token below.

session token of fahap-hawip = htk31_7852f2b3276dba2738f98fa97f92237

- [ ] **Key ceremony step 7: unseal the font-vendoring signing key.** Before vendoring the Quillstone third-party font bundle into the Marrowlight monorepo, the on-call engineer must verify license manifests match the checked-in inventory, confirm checksums for each vendored face, and record witnesses in the ceremony log. Once both witnesses have signed, unlock the signing enclave using the recovery passphrase that follows.

unlock words, kagef-taduf: fenir-quenix-norwyn-sorvan-gormir-gorir-fraok

Hi Dorit,

Taking leave Friday, so here's the FlagWeaver state. The rollout framework stores flag definitions and percentage cohorts in the `flagstore` database; the evaluator caches reads for 30 seconds, so expect brief staleness after any update. Two rollouts are mid-flight — `checkout-v3` at 25% and `dark-mode` at 50%. Do not truncate `cohort_assignments`; it breaks stickiness. Audit triggers log every change to `flag_audit`, so work through the admin CLI where possible. The primary connection string is below.

— Pavlen

primary connection of yagep-kahip = redis://giliel_svc:zYiKsLL2PLpfPL@db-348f.xolmarsys.corp:5432/fenwyn